## Limits and Quotas: Bloomgate Filter

The Bloomgate filter sits in front of the Kestrelstore key-value cluster and rejects lookups for keys that almost certainly don't exist. False-positive rates rise sharply once the filter exceeds its sizing budget, so support staff should verify quota alerts before escalating to the Kestrelstore team. The constants below govern sizing and rotation.

tuning table, bagag-tahop:
THRESHOLDS = {
    "eliael": 792,
    "pramir": 583,
    "belys": 750,
    "ulaax": 865,
    "holiel": 732,
    "lamath": 599,
    "julwyn": 683,
}

// Sampling rate for Heronbeak telemetry logs.
// Heronbeak emits ~9k lines/sec at peak; full capture
// melted the Driftvale aggregator twice. Keep this at
// 1-in-200 unless debugging, and revert before merge.
// If you change it, note the change against the build
// token recorded below.

pipeline stamp: htk9_ce63042d9

The Ordwell service soft-deletes rows in the orders table rather than removing them; a deleted_at timestamp marks the row and a nightly reaper archives anything older than 90 days. This behavior differs per environment: the reaper is disabled in dev, runs hourly in staging, and nightly in production. Queries must always filter on deleted_at, or counts will be wrong. The environment-specific reaper and retention settings currently deployed are as follows.

settings of bahop-kaweg:
[novael]
host = novael.braskstack.example
user = novael_svc
database = novael_prod

**Action item 7 (owner: storage team):** After the Quillhaven 3.9 upgrade, the query planner began choosing sequential scans over the `orders_by_region` index, inflating p95 latency roughly fourfold. New team members should understand this class of regression before touching planner hints. We agreed to add a canary query suite to every upgrade checklist. The full investigation notes and reproduction steps live on the internal wiki page.

dashboard of bafof-hafog = https://confluence.lumiclabs.internal/display/browse/display/6a09a20a